The solutions to many of our most pressing social and environmental problems require large-scale change to our social systems. For example, effectively mitigating and adapting to climate change requires coordinated changes across our food, transport, industrial, finance and other social systems. Complicating matters is the fact that these systems are interlinked: what happens in one affects what happens in another. Faced with such daunting and high-stakes challenge, it is crucial to ask: what can be done to make such positive systemic change more likely to be successful?
In this research paper, Chad Lee-Stronach and Rory Smead develop a dynamic model of systemic social coordination to answer this question. They discover the surprising result that approaches that are reliably effective in isolated cases of coordination are often ineffective, even counterproductive, when scaled up to cases of systemic coordination. They identify other approaches that, according to their model, may be more reliably effective. This research is part of broader research project on understanding the dynamics of systemic social change.
